儿童特发性血小板减少性紫癜血小板功能研究

摘    要:目的研究儿童特发性血小板减少性紫癜(ITP)血小板体内活化状态及体外活化功能,探讨血小板在ITP发病机制中的作用。方法流式细胞术(FCM)检测体内和体外5’-二磷酸腺苷(ADP)刺激后血小板表面活化分子GPIIb/IIIa和CD62P分子的表达,同时检测CD62P阳性血小板该分子的平均荧光强度(MCF)。结果ITP组与对照组体内活化血小板百分比有显著性差异(P=0.0001),ITP组显著低于对照组;两组CD62P分子的MCF无显著性差异。体外刺激血小板活化后,两组活化血小板百分比有显著性差异(P=0.0077),ITP组低于对照组;两组CD62P分子的MCF有显著性差异(P=0.0059),ITP组低于对照组。结论ITP患儿体内血小板处于低活化状态,提示其出血原因不仅是血小板数量减少,同时存在血小板功能减低,低活化的原因很可能是血小板自身功能障碍。

Study on platelet functions in childhood idiopathic thrombocytopenic purpura

Abstract:Objective To explore the activation state of platelets in vivo and their ability to be activated in vitro after being stimulated for studying platelets function in the pathogenesis of childhood idiopathic thrombocytopenic purpura(ITP). Methods Measure the expression of GPIIb/IIIa and CD62P which are the markers of activated platelets in vivo by flow cytometry(FCM), and measure the mean channel fluroscence(MCF) of CD62P on CD62-positive platelets both in vivo and following platelets stimulated by ADP in vitro. Results The percentage of activated platelets in vivo in ITP group is statistically different from that in control group(P=0.0001), the former being distinctively lower than the latter. There is no statistical difference between the two groups in MCF of CD62P. After platelets were stimulated in vitro, the percentage of activated platelets is lower in ITP group than in control group(P=0.0077). MCF of CD62P is distinctively lower in ITP group than that in control group(P=0.0059).Conclusion In childhood ITP, the platelets in vivo is in lower activation, which may suggest that the reason of hemorrhage in ITP is not only the decrease of platelets count, but also the depression of platelets function. Lower activated platelets could be involved in the pathogenesis of childhood ITP.The reason of platelets lower activated may be platelets dysfunction.
